Turn main switch on the robot control cabinet to “OFF” and secure it with a pad-
lock to prevent unauthorized persons from switching it on again.
(3) Release and unplug all connectors from the junction boxes (Fig. 15/1).
(4) Remove electric cables and hose lines from both interfaces of energy supply system
A 1 and all other peripheral supply lines to the robot, where necessary.
Depressurize and drain hose lines beforehand.
(5) Remove eight M24x100--8.8 ISO 4017 hexagon bolts (2) together with lock washers.
(6) Raise robot with lifting tackle (3) attached to three eyebolts on the rotating column.
For reasons of safety, it is imperative for the lifting tackle to be attached to the
robot at the specified points. Risk of injury!
The transport instructions in the robot Doc. Module “Repair, General” must be
observed.
